在数字化时代,表单作为网站与用户互动的重要桥梁,其设计直接影响着用户体验。随着移动设备的普及,响应式设计成为了表单设计的关键。本文将探讨如何通过响应式设计打造流畅的表单体验。
响应式设计的重要性
1. 适应不同设备
随着用户使用各种设备访问网站,如手机、平板电脑和桌面电脑,表单需要在不同屏幕尺寸和分辨率下都能良好显示和操作。
2. 提高用户体验
良好的响应式设计能够减少用户在填写表单时的困扰,提高完成率,从而提升整体的用户体验。
3. 增强搜索引擎优化(SEO)
搜索引擎更倾向于推荐响应式设计的网站,因为它们能够为用户提供更好的访问体验。
响应式表单设计要点
1. 简洁明了的布局
- 减少干扰元素:在表单设计中,保持简洁是关键。避免过多的装饰和干扰元素,让用户专注于填写表单。
- 清晰的指示:使用清晰的标签和指示,帮助用户了解每个字段的作用。
2. 适应不同屏幕尺寸
- 流体布局:使用流体布局,使表单元素能够根据屏幕尺寸自动调整大小和位置。
- 媒体查询:利用CSS媒体查询,为不同屏幕尺寸设置不同的样式。
3. 优化输入体验
- 自动填充:利用HTML5的自动填充功能,减少用户输入工作量。
- 输入验证:提供实时验证,帮助用户及时纠正错误。
4. 优化移动端体验
- 单列布局:在移动端,采用单列布局,使表单元素更加紧凑。
- 大号按钮:使用大号按钮,方便用户在触控屏上点击。
实例分析
以下是一个简单的响应式表单示例: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>响应式表单示例</title>
<style>
form {
max-width: 600px;
margin: 0 auto;
}
@media (max-width: 768px) {
form {
padding: 10px;
}
}
</style>
</head>
<body>
<form action="#" method="post">
<label for="name">姓名:</label>
<input type="text" id="name" name="name" required>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<button type="submit">提交</button>
</form>
</body>
</html>
在这个示例中,我们使用了流体布局和媒体查询来适应不同屏幕尺寸,同时提供了输入验证和自动填充功能。
总结
响应式设计是打造流畅表单的关键。通过以上要点和实例分析,相信您已经对如何设计响应式表单有了更深入的了解。在今后的工作中,不断优化表单设计,为用户提供更好的体验。
